FileWriter is meant for writing streams of characters. It will use the default character encoding and the default byte-buffer size. In other words, it is a wrapper class of FileOutputStream for convenience. Therefore, to specify these values yourself, consider using a FileOutputStream. oracle
FileWriter is a subclass of OutputStreamWriter class that is used to write text (as opposed to binary data) to a file. app
So if you want to handle binary data such as image file as in your case, you should be using FileOutputStream instead of FileWriter. ide
import java.io.FileWriter; import java.io.Writer; public class WriterTest { /** * @param args */ public static void main(String[] args) { // TODO Auto-generated method stub try { Writer writer = new FileWriter("helloworld.txt"); String str = "hello test1"; writer.write(str); writer.flush(); writer.close(); } catch (Exception e) { e.printStackTrace(); } } }

Whether to use streams of bytes or characters? It really depends. Both have buffers. InputStream/OutputStream provide more flexibility, but will make your “simple” program complex. On the other hand, FileWriter/FileReader give a neat solution but you lose the control. flex
